IMPORTANT NOTICE!

To avoid possible injury, read the enclosed instructions carefully
before installing/operating this garage door opener. Pay close
attention to all warnings and notes. This manual MUST be attached
to the wall in close proximity to the garage door opener.

PHOTOELECTRIC EYES
ARE NOT REQUIRED

ON WAYNE-DALTON SERIES 9000 AND MODEL
5120 AND 5140 DOORS. ALL OTHER DOORS,
WHICH DO NOT HAVE PINCH-RESISTANT SECTION
JOINTS, REQUIRE PHOTOELECTRIC EYES TO PRE-
VENT POSSIBLE SEVERE OR FATAL INJURY.

WARNING
